Product Overview
LTC6994-2 is a programmable delay block with a range of 1µs to 33.6 seconds. Th device is part of the TimerBlox® family of versatile silicon timing devices. A single resistor, RSET, programs an internal host oscillator frequency, setting the device’s time base. The output (OUT) follows the input (IN) after delaying the rising and/or falling transitions. It will delay the rising or falling edge. It offers the ability to dynamically adjust the delay time via a separate control voltage. It is used in applications such as noise discriminators/pulse qualifiers, delay matching, switch debouncing, high vibration, high acceleration environments, portable and battery-powered equipment.
- Configured with 1 to 3 resistors
- Delay one or both rising/falling edges
- Single supply operation range from 2.25V to 5.5V
- CMOS output driver sources/sinks 20mA
- Delay accuracy is ±2.3% maximum at (TA = 25°C)
- Supply current is 165µA typical at (RL = ∞, RSET = 50K, NDIV ≤ 64)
- VSET drift over temperature is ±75µV/°C typical at (TA = 25°C)
- Output current is ±20mA typical at (V+ = 2.7V to 5.5V)
- Operating temperature is -40°C to 85°C
- Package style is 6-lead plastic TSOT-23
